Frequently asked questions
What CFM do I need for woodworking dust collection?
Woodworking typically requires 350-500 CFM per machine, depending on tool size and dust generation rate.
How does duct size affect CFM requirements?
Smaller ducts increase air velocity and pressure drop, potentially reducing actual CFM and collection efficiency.
What's the difference between capture velocity and transport velocity?
Capture velocity draws dust into the system, while transport velocity maintains particle movement through ductwork.
